Market Snapshot: Magnetic Coupled Mixers Market Size and Growth

The magnetic coupled mixers market is on an upward trajectory, valued at USD 495.26 million in 2024 and projected to reach USD 540.85 million in 2025, advancing at a CAGR of 9.09%. Forward-looking estimates position the market at USD 993.72 million by 2032. This expansion is driven by the increasing emphasis on advanced process integrity, adoption in chemicals and pharmaceuticals, and shifting regulatory frameworks. Tariff Impact: Supply Chain and Cost Management Considerations

Forthcoming United States tariffs in 2025 are prompting manufacturers and original equipment manufacturers to optimize their supply chains for magnetic coupled mixers. Rising material costs compel companies to qualify new suppliers, localize assembly, and explore alternative materials in product design. In response, industry leaders focus on flexible modular designs and enhanced supplier transparency to offset volatility, sustain operational performance, and adapt to external cost pressures.
